How they compare

France currently reports 223.48 million kg against 182.84 million kg in Egypt, a difference of 40.64 million kg.

That makes France's figure about 1.2 times Egypt's.

Across all 65 years both countries report, France has been ahead every year.

Egypt ranks 13th and France ranks 10th of 199 countries.

France has averaged higher in every one of the 9 decades both report.

Head to head by decade

Decade Egypt France Difference Ahead
1960s 24.89 million kg 93.74 million kg 68.85 million kg France
1970s 40.27 million kg 174.22 million kg 133.94 million kg France
1980s 67.46 million kg 239.91 million kg 172.45 million kg France
1990s 87.20 million kg 242.34 million kg 155.13 million kg France
2000s 118.88 million kg 224.27 million kg 105.40 million kg France
2010s 120.83 million kg 213.14 million kg 92.30 million kg France
2020s 130.81 million kg 188.51 million kg 57.70 million kg France
2030s 152.40 million kg 222.12 million kg 69.72 million kg France
2050s 182.84 million kg 223.48 million kg 40.64 million kg France

Averages of every year both report within each decade.

The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
